#3b3ee4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b3ee4 is composed of 23.1% red, 24.3%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.1% cyan, 72.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 238.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.8% and a lightness of 56.3%. #3b3ee4 color hex could be obtained by blending #767cff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#3b3ee4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01020b is the darkest color, while #f9f9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b3ee4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888897 is the less saturated color, while #2125fe is the most saturated one.
